Understanding the Causes of Water Damage
Before exploring solutions, it is essential to understand the common causes of water damage. These include:
- Heavy rainfall and flooding
- Leaking or burst pipes
- Faulty appliances or plumbing issues
- Poor drainage systems

Prevention Measures
Regular Maintenance
Consistent maintenance of plumbing and drainage systems is key to preventing water damage. This includes:
- Inspecting pipes and hoses regularly
- Cleaning gutters and downspouts
- Ensuring proper grading around the property

Utilizing Advanced Technologies
The use of advanced technologies like moisture detection devices and smart home systems can aid in early detection and prevention of water damage. These tools provide:
- Real-time monitoring of moisture levels
- Automated alerts for potential issues
- Integration with home security systems

Remediation Techniques
Professional Water Extraction and Drying
When water damage occurs, swift action is crucial. Professional services often provide comprehensive water extraction and drying solutions, including:
- High-powered extraction equipment
- Industrial-grade dehumidifiers
- Thermal imaging to detect hidden moisture

Restoration and Repairs
Post-damage restoration is vital to return a property to its pre-damage condition. This process often involves:
- Repairing structural damage
- Replacing damaged materials
- Sanitizing and deodorizing affected areas
Engaging skilled professionals can ensure a seamless restoration process, safeguarding the property’s integrity and value.
